Six
Her eyes burned in the morning. Moira rubbed them and forced herself to sit up. A scent teased her nose, and she drew in a deep breath then scanned the room.
“Good morning, Lady Matheson.” A young girl offered Moira a soft smile as she opened one of the window shutters, spilling bright morning light into the chamber. “Asgree had the cook mull ye some cider. It will help wake ye.”
The cider was on the bedside table, but Moira didn’t reach for it. She hugged the bedding close to hide her nude body.
“I am Alanna, and Asgree sent me to look after ye, since ye have none of yer own maids with ye.” Alanna picked up Moira’s undergown and wrinkled her nose. “It was wise of ye to discard this before crawling into bed. The sheets would have been ruined, and that would have been a shame.” Alanna’s cheeks reddened, and she cast a nervous look toward Moira. “Forgive me, Lady Matheson, me mother always said I talked too much.”
“Do nae worry,” Moira assured her. “It is a happy morning.”
Alanna smiled wide. “Oh, it is indeed! Ye need to dress so ye can see the young lad be baptized.”
She opened one of the wardrobes that sat in the room. There were a great number of them set between the windows, and all standing as high as Alanna’s head. With the doors open, Moira could see that the wardrobe was full of garments. She couldn’t help but be jealous of such plenty. She’d never owned more than one chemise at a time.
With the morning light, Moira was able to enjoy the beauty of the chamber as well. It was indeed a star chamber. She sipped at the cider as she looked at the constellations painted so perfectly on the walls.
“The last countess enjoyed painting,” Alanna remarked. She held out an undergown in a soft blue color that complemented Moira’s blond hair and matched her eyes. “She also enjoyed fine clothing. This will suit yer coloring well.”
“It’s silk,” Moira said and shook her head.
“Asgree told me to dress ye finely. Lady Sutherland has decided ye shall stand as godmother.”
“I could nae.” Moira’s mouth went dry just thinking of the fit Bari would have.
Alanna’s eyes rounded. “Oh, but ye must. I’ve got a silver penny bet on ye.” She slapped a hand over her mouth—but too late.
“What do ye mean?” Moira set the cider aside and left the bed. At least she was getting a little more accustomed to being nude in front of other women; her cheeks warmed only slightly.
Alanna shrugged and shook the underrobe so it rippled welcomingly. “Lady Daphne is a spirited lass. She told her husband that ye would be the godmother because ye caught the babe. The young laird was quite set against it, but she did nae back down. She promised him she’d be off to visit with her brother, Saer MacLeod, if he did nae soften his heart toward ye.”
She gathered up the underrobe and helped Moira into it.
